tkCybernetics is a simulation software that can be used to create and evaluate simple cybernetic circuits as a combination of lowpass and highpass filters and several nonlinear elements. tkCybernetics has been developed for and successfully applied to introductory courses on biological cybernetics at Bielefeld University. Therefore, it is recommended for students who start learning about cybernetics. Students can quickly grasp the concepts used in the graphical user interface and are able to create their own circuits after a short introduction to the program. Its usefulness for advanced students and researchers is limited to quickly testing circuits. This article provides detailed tutorial information on how to install and work with tkCybernetics for self-learning and for higher education.

Under the brand name “sciebo – the Campuscloud” (derived from “science box”) a consortium of more than 20 research and applied science universities started a large scale cloud service for about 500,000 students and researchers in North Rhine-Westphalia, Germany’s most populous state. Starting with the much anticipated data privacy compliant sync & share functionality, sciebo offers the potential to become a more general cloud platform for collaboration and research data management which will be actively pursued in upcoming scientific and infrastructural projects. This project report describes the formation of the venture, its targets and the technical and the legal solution as well as the current status and the next steps.
